summ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--conf/distro/angstrom-2008.1.conf1
-rw-r--r--contrib/angstrom/source-mirror.txt14
-rw-r--r--packages/neuros-public/neuros-lib-widgets_git.bb8
-rw-r--r--packages/neuros-public/neuros-mainmenu_git.bb23
-rw-r--r--packages/neuros-public/neuros-nwm_git.bb22
-rw-r--r--packages/neuros-public/neuros-qt-plugins_git.bb3
-rw-r--r--packages/python/python-setuptools-native_0.6c8.bb4
-rw-r--r--packages/python/python-setuptools/.mtn2git_empty0
-rw-r--r--packages/python/python-setuptools/fix-log-usage.patch13
-rw-r--r--packages/python/python-setuptools_0.6c8.bb7
10 files changed, 88 insertions, 7 deletions
diff --git a/conf/distro/angstrom-2008.1.conf b/conf/distro/angstrom-2008.1.conf
index 3026e6f043..004d6e9811 100644
--- a/conf/distro/angstrom-2008.1.conf
+++ b/conf/distro/angstrom-2008.1.conf
@@ -111,7 +111,6 @@ PREFERRED_VERSION_gcc-cross-sdk ?= "${ANGSTROM_GCC_VERSION}"
PREFERRED_VERSION_gcc-cross-initial ?= "${ANGSTROM_GCC_VERSION}"
#Loads preferred versions from files, these have weak assigments (?=), so put them at the bottom
-require conf/distro/include/preferred-gpe-versions-2.8.inc
require conf/distro/include/preferred-e-versions.inc
require conf/distro/include/preferred-xorg-versions-X11R7.3.inc
diff --git a/contrib/angstrom/source-mirror.txt b/contrib/angstrom/source-mirror.txt
new file mode 100644
index 0000000000..1c480e730d
--- /dev/null
+++ b/contrib/angstrom/source-mirror.txt
@@ -0,0 +1,14 @@
+#To populate the source mirror the autobuilder uses the following command:
+
+rsync ~/OE/downloads/ angstrom@linuxtogo.org:~/website/unstable/sources/ -av \
+ --exclude "*.md5" \
+ --exclude "svn" \
+ --exclude "cvs" \
+ --exclude "git" \
+ --exclude "umac.ko" \
+ --exclude "IPL_ixp400NpeLibrary-2_3_2.zip" \
+ --exclude "*.lock" \
+ --exclude "codec_*" \
+ --exclude "dsplink*" \
+ --progress
+
diff --git a/packages/neuros-public/neuros-lib-widgets_git.bb b/packages/neuros-public/neuros-lib-widgets_git.bb
index 0e1e22e6d2..45dde3c14a 100644
--- a/packages/neuros-public/neuros-lib-widgets_git.bb
+++ b/packages/neuros-public/neuros-lib-widgets_git.bb
@@ -1,6 +1,9 @@
DESCRIPTION = "Neuros qt-plugins"
LICENSE = "GPL"
+PV = "0.0+${PR}+gitr${SRCREV}"
+PR = "r1"
+
DEPENDS = "qt-embedded"
inherit qtopia4core
@@ -14,4 +17,7 @@ do_install() {
install -m 0755 ${S}/build/lib* ${D}/${libdir}
}
-
+do_stage() {
+ install -d ${STAGING_LIBDIR}
+ install -m 0755 ${S}/build/lib* ${STAGING_LIBDIR}
+}
diff --git a/packages/neuros-public/neuros-mainmenu_git.bb b/packages/neuros-public/neuros-mainmenu_git.bb
new file mode 100644
index 0000000000..c16cbeb036
--- /dev/null
+++ b/packages/neuros-public/neuros-mainmenu_git.bb
@@ -0,0 +1,23 @@
+DESCRIPTION = "Neuros window manager"
+LICENSE = "GPL"
+
+PV = "0.0+${PR}+gitr${SRCREV}"
+PR = "r0"
+
+DEPENDS = "qt-embedded"
+
+inherit qtopia4core
+
+SRCREV = "27fc35bd349ccbac1226ebb3d41417d8164b7dd1"
+SRC_URI = "git://git.neurostechnology.com/git/app-mainmenu;protocol=git"
+S = "${WORKDIR}/git/"
+
+do_install() {
+ install -d ${D}/${bindir}
+ install -m 0755 ${S}/build/main-menu ${D}/${bindir}
+
+ install -d ${D}/${sysconfdir}/menu
+ install -m 0644 ${S}/resources/menu/* ${D}/${sysconfdir}/menu
+}
+
+
diff --git a/packages/neuros-public/neuros-nwm_git.bb b/packages/neuros-public/neuros-nwm_git.bb
new file mode 100644
index 0000000000..6dbbd4cabd
--- /dev/null
+++ b/packages/neuros-public/neuros-nwm_git.bb
@@ -0,0 +1,22 @@
+DESCRIPTION = "Neuros window manager"
+LICENSE = "GPL"
+
+PV = "0.0+${PR}+gitr${SRCREV}"
+PR = "r2"
+
+DEPENDS = "qt-embedded"
+
+inherit qtopia4core
+
+SRCREV = "d0b6789dde38d321d3c90c04512a4ea43e28e79e"
+SRC_URI = "git://git.neurostechnology.com/git/app-nwm;protocol=git"
+S = "${WORKDIR}/git/"
+
+do_configure_prepend() {
+ rm ${S}/src/Makefile || true
+}
+
+do_install() {
+ install -d ${D}/${bindir}
+ install -m 0755 ${S}/build/nwm ${D}/${bindir}
+}
diff --git a/packages/neuros-public/neuros-qt-plugins_git.bb b/packages/neuros-public/neuros-qt-plugins_git.bb
index d0de64d945..62a9d43fca 100644
--- a/packages/neuros-public/neuros-qt-plugins_git.bb
+++ b/packages/neuros-public/neuros-qt-plugins_git.bb
@@ -1,7 +1,8 @@
DESCRIPTION = "Neuros qt-plugins"
LICENSE = "GPL"
-PR = "r1"
+PV = "0.0+${PR}+gitr${SRCREV}"
+PR = "r2"
DEPENDS = "qt-embedded"
diff --git a/packages/python/python-setuptools-native_0.6c8.bb b/packages/python/python-setuptools-native_0.6c8.bb
index b7716d8cac..0bbf9c32fc 100644
--- a/packages/python/python-setuptools-native_0.6c8.bb
+++ b/packages/python/python-setuptools-native_0.6c8.bb
@@ -1,9 +1,9 @@
require python-setuptools_${PV}.bb
inherit native
+FILESPATH = "${FILE_DIRNAME}/python-setuptools"
DEPENDS = "python-native"
do_stage() {
- BUILD_SYS=${BUILD_SYS} HOST_SYS=${HOST_SYS} \
- ${STAGING_BINDIR_NATIVE}/python setup.py install
+ distutils_stage_all
}
diff --git a/packages/python/python-setuptools/.mtn2git_empty b/packages/python/python-setuptools/.mtn2git_empty
new file mode 100644
index 0000000000..e69de29bb2
--- /dev/null
+++ b/packages/python/python-setuptools/.mtn2git_empty
diff --git a/packages/python/python-setuptools/fix-log-usage.patch b/packages/python/python-setuptools/fix-log-usage.patch
new file mode 100644
index 0000000000..6363c850c2
--- /dev/null
+++ b/packages/python/python-setuptools/fix-log-usage.patch
@@ -0,0 +1,13 @@
+Index: setuptools-0.6c8/setuptools/command/sdist.py
+===================================================================
+--- setuptools-0.6c8.orig/setuptools/command/sdist.py
++++ setuptools-0.6c8/setuptools/command/sdist.py
+@@ -95,7 +95,7 @@ def entries_finder(dirname, filename):
+ for match in entries_pattern.finditer(data):
+ yield joinpath(dirname,unescape(match.group(1)))
+ else:
+- log.warn("unrecognized .svn/entries format in %s", dirname)
++ print ("unrecognized .svn/entries format in %s", dirname)
+
+
+ finders = [
diff --git a/packages/python/python-setuptools_0.6c8.bb b/packages/python/python-setuptools_0.6c8.bb
index 19f73d3f67..5b82ecea69 100644
--- a/packages/python/python-setuptools_0.6c8.bb
+++ b/packages/python/python-setuptools_0.6c8.bb
@@ -5,9 +5,12 @@ PRIORITY = "optional"
LICENSE = "MIT-like"
RDEPENDS = "python-distutils python-compression"
SRCNAME = "setuptools"
-PR = "ml0"
+PR = "ml1"
-SRC_URI = "http://cheeseshop.python.org/packages/source/s/setuptools/${SRCNAME}-${PV}.tar.gz"
+SRC_URI = "\
+ http://cheeseshop.python.org/packages/source/s/setuptools/${SRCNAME}-${PV}.tar.gz\
+ file://fix-log-usage.patch;patch=1 \
+"
S = "${WORKDIR}/${SRCNAME}-${PV}"
inherit distutils